Justification for selection of acute toxicity – oral endpoint
The acute oral toxicity in mouse overview indicates values with moderate reliability index. The acute oral toxicity in rat overview indicates values with borderline reliability index. Therefore, the predicted value in mouse was selected.

Justification for classification or non-classification

The substance can be allocated to toxicity category 4, based on the LD50 oral according to the numeric criteria shown in Table 3.1.1 of Regulation 1272/2008 (CLP).

Therefore 1-(3-chlorophenyl)-4-(3-chloropropyl)piperazinium chloride is classified as Harmful if swallowed (Ac.tox.4 - H302).
